VPS服务器IP控流全攻略:从配置到优化的完整指南
如何有效控制VPS服务器的IP流量?
| 技术参数 | 推荐配置 | 说明 |
|---|---|---|
| CPU | 多核(如Intel Xeon E5-2620) | 建议至少4核以保障虚拟化性能 |
| 内存 | 8GB ECC以上 | 确保每个VPS实例有足够资源 |
| 存储 | 1TB SAS硬盘 | 建议SSD提升I/O性能 |
| 网络带宽 | 3M独享起 | 根据业务需求选择更高带宽 |
| 操作系统 | CentOS/Ubuntu/Windows Server | Linux系统资源占用少,Windows兼容性好 |
| 虚拟化软件 | KVM/Xen/VMware | KVM性能最优,Xen隔离性最好 |
| IP数量 | 1-256个可扩展 | 多IP需服务商支持,通常按需购买 |
VPS服务器IP流量控制与管理指南
一、VPS服务器IP控流技术概述
VPS(Virtual Private Server)是通过虚拟化技术将物理服务器分割为多个虚拟服务器的托管服务,每个VPS拥有独立的公网IP地址、操作系统和资源配置^^1^^2^^。IP控流技术主要包括以下核心功能:- 流量监控:实时监测每个IP的入站/出站流量
- 带宽限制:设置每个IP的最大带宽使用上限
- IP切换:动态更换IP地址规避限制
- 路由控制:配置特定IP的流量走向
二、VPS服务器IP控流配置步骤
1. 硬件与网络准备
| 组件 | 最低要求 | 推荐配置 |
|---|---|---|
| CPU | 双核 | 四核Intel Xeon E5-2620 |
| 内存 | 4GB | 8GB ECC |
| 存储 | 60GB HDD | 1TB SSD |
| 网络带宽 | 1M共享 | 3M独享 |
网络设备需配备支持QoS功能的路由器和交换机^^5^^。
2. 软件环境搭建
# Linux系统安装KVM虚拟化
sudo apt update
sudo apt install qemu-kvm libvirt-daemon-system bridge-utils
sudo systemctl start libvirtd
sudo systemctl enable libvirtd
Windows系统建议使用Hyper-V或VMware Workstation^^5^^。
3. IP流量控制配置
# 使用TC(Traffic Control)工具限速
sudo tc qdisc add dev eth0 root handle 1: htb default 12
sudo tc class add dev eth0 parent 1: classid 1:1 htb rate 1mbit ceil 1mbit
sudo tc filter add dev eth0 protocol ip parent 1:0 prio 1 u32 match ip dst 192.168.1.100 flowid 1:1
三、常见问题解决方案
| 问题现象 | 可能原因 | 解决方案 |
|---|---|---|
| IP被封禁 | 高频请求/违规内容 | 1. 联系服务商申诉2. 切换备用IP^^6^^ |
| 流量异常 | DDoS攻击/配置错误 | 1. 检查iptables规则2. 启用流量清洗服务^^7^^ |
| 带宽不足 | 资源超售/突发流量 | 1. 升级带宽套餐2. 实施QoS策略^^8^^ |
| IP冲突 | 网络配置错误 | 1. 检查ARP表2. 重新分配IP地址^^9^^ |
四、高级应用场景
- 外贸多IP运营:通过拨号VPS实现IP动态切换,规避平台检测^^10^^
- 游戏服务器:为不同地区玩家分配最优IP,降低延迟^^11^^
- 数据采集:配置IP池轮换,避免反爬机制封锁^^4^^
发表评论